Stellah is a variant of Stella, derived from the Latin word 'stella' meaning 'star.' Historically, it symbolizes brightness, guidance, and hope. The name gained popularity in the Renaissance, often used in literature and poetry to represent shining beauty and aspiration.

Cultural Significance of Stellah

The name Stellah, rooted in Latin, has been historically linked to celestial imagery and guidance. In various cultures, stars have symbolized hope, destiny, and protection. The Renaissance period especially embraced the name Stella, from which Stellah derives, in literature and art, associating it with divine beauty and inspiration. Over time, Stellah and its variants have maintained a timeless appeal, representing brightness in darkness.

In modern times, Stellah is a charming and unique variant of the more common Stella, appealing to parents seeking a blend of classic elegance and individuality. It enjoys moderate popularity in English-speaking countries and is favored for its melodic sound and celestial meaning. The name fits well in contemporary naming trends that emphasize nature and cosmic themes, making Stellah a fresh yet familiar choice.
